As an airliner with Hokkaido-based aficionado, Air Do chose Vulpix and its Alolan variant because both Pokémon and Hokkaido have been named leader of the Hokkaido Aficionado Expedition since November 2018. It was part of the Pokemon Local Acts project, where The Pokemon Company helps promote Japans prefecture by providing certain Pokemon to the regional ambassadorial mascots. Air Dos Vulpix-decorated Rokon Jet will hit the market on December 1, 2021. The exact flight schedule will be announced later.
